Bill Morée has extensive experience delivering compelling and persuasive photographs for political campaigns for races at all levels. He has photographed presidents and presidential candidates - including Barack Obama, Bill Clinton, Hilary Rodham Clinton, and Bernie Sanders - and shot stills for commercials for Joe Biden, Jamie Raskin, Roy Cooper, and many others. His work is generally shot on location in the home districts of candidates around the country. He has shot in 49 states so far. (Your guess as to which one is missing?)
His work for progressive causes includes photographing Emily’s List endorsed candidates for IE communications, the American Wind Energy Association’s support for the installation of wind turbines, member communications campaigns for the National Education Association, the Postal Workers Union Association, and the AFL-CIO in dozens of states, a get-out-the-vote campaign for Native Americans in North Dakota, and many, many more.
Bill Morée holds an MFA in studio art from New Mexico State University and a BFA in photography from Pratt Institute.
He is based in Washington DC and in the Black Range Mountains in southern New Mexico.
